Abstract: A solidifier for a liquid, the solidifier comprising a mixture of absorbents having different apparent densities whereby at least one absorbent is negatively buoyant and at least one absorbent is positively buoyant relative to the liquid sought to be solidified. Packaging for the solidifier is disclosed for effecting selective dispersal of the solidifier within the liquid sought to be solidified.
Abstract: A package of strung medical sponges, particularly neurosurgical sponges comprising a plurality of sponges releasably held on a planar member such as a card which is self-supporting and suitable for grasping in one's hand. The strings of the sponges are threaded upon the card in a manner that permits the ready removal of the sponges one by one and which captures the tails of the strings to provided a neat and efficient package.
